Lines Matching refs:TrySU
1395 SUnit *TrySU = Interferences[i]; in PickNodeToScheduleBottomUp() local
1396 SmallVectorImpl<unsigned> &LRegs = LRegsMap[TrySU]; in PickNodeToScheduleBottomUp()
1409 if (!WillCreateCycle(TrySU, BtSU)) { in PickNodeToScheduleBottomUp()
1411 BacktrackBottomUp(TrySU, BtSU); in PickNodeToScheduleBottomUp()
1421 << TrySU->NodeNum << ")\n"); in PickNodeToScheduleBottomUp()
1422 AddPred(TrySU, SDep(BtSU, SDep::Artificial)); in PickNodeToScheduleBottomUp()
1426 if (!TrySU->isAvailable || !TrySU->NodeQueueId) in PickNodeToScheduleBottomUp()
1430 AvailableQueue->remove(TrySU); in PickNodeToScheduleBottomUp()
1431 CurSU = TrySU; in PickNodeToScheduleBottomUp()
1444 SUnit *TrySU = Interferences[0]; in PickNodeToScheduleBottomUp() local
1445 SmallVectorImpl<unsigned> &LRegs = LRegsMap[TrySU]; in PickNodeToScheduleBottomUp()
1471 DEBUG(dbgs() << " Adding an edge from SU #" << TrySU->NodeNum in PickNodeToScheduleBottomUp()
1473 AddPred(TrySU, SDep(Copies.front(), SDep::Artificial)); in PickNodeToScheduleBottomUp()
1478 << " to SU #" << TrySU->NodeNum << "\n"); in PickNodeToScheduleBottomUp()
1480 AddPred(NewDef, SDep(TrySU, SDep::Artificial)); in PickNodeToScheduleBottomUp()
1481 TrySU->isAvailable = false; in PickNodeToScheduleBottomUp()